About the Item

A rare set of four Regency black painted standard or dining chairs with rush seats. Each chair is complemented with hand painted characterful backrests adorned with classical and floral motifs with beautiful colouring and texture. Each chair has double parallel stretchers to the sides united by a X-shape stretcher to the front beneath the seat. The stretchers are complemented with subtle freehand pen work in gold to each. All raised on gently sweeping turned saber legs. The chairs are strong and sturdy with no movement to the joints and good for everyday use in the home. A remarkable set of chairs in wonderful country house condition. The price is for the set of four chairs. English, circa 1815. TOTAL H: 82 CM H: 32.2 INCHES W: 46.5 CM W: 18.3 INCHES D: 50 CM D: 19.6 INCHES SEAT HEIGHT H: 45 CM H: 17.7 INCHES SEAT DEPTH D: 40 CM D: 15.7 INCHES
